JIS Z 9015-1:1999Sampling procedures for inspection by attributes Part 1: Sampling plans indexed by acceptable quality level (AQL) for lot-by-lot inspection
Abstract
This part of JIS Z 9015 specifies an acceptance sampling system for inspection by attributes. It is indexed in terms of the Acceptable Quality Level (AQL). Its purpose is to induce a supplier through the economic and psychological pressure of lot non-acceptance to maintain a process at least as good as the specified AQL, while at the same time providing an upper limit for the risk to the consumer of accepting the occasional poor lot. Sampling plans designated in this part of JIS Z 9015 are applicable, but not limited, to inspection of a) end items, b) components and raw materials, c) operations, d) materials in process, e) supplies in storage, f) maintenance operations, g) data or records, h) administrative procedures.
